An exciting opportunity has arisen within the University Hospitals Dorset MSK Therapy Team for a part-time band 7 enhanced practice physiotherapist. This role would involve working in a supported clinical role as a spinal interface clinician within the DMSK spinal service. This will involve using enhanced level of practice skills in the assessment, diagnosis, and shared decision-making for patients with spinal pain or pathology. This post would be supported by our team of established spinal advanced practitioners and involve responsibilities for education and supervision within the wider MSK therapy team including clinical supervision.

To take a clinical leadership role in the delivery of therapy services to MSK therapy patients treated at University Hospitals Dorset and within the DMSK surgical interface service. This post will predominantly involve the delivery of outpatient clinical care for the spinal DMSK service. The post holder will provide skilled leadership and responsibility for service development, the setting and monitoring of standards of practice, and implement policy and policy changes in their clinical area. Furthermore, they will participate and lead quality improvement projects across MSK Therapy and make recommendations to the team and service leads.
What We Offer: Management support to continue learning, with support from both the MSK Therapy Service and DMSK leadership structures. This role involves enhanced practice, and the successful candidate will be supported in the training and delivery of enhanced practice skills to support their core practice. This may include imaging requesting and interpretation skills.
